Soos writes about pain and despair, aging, his divorce, his father’s passing, regret, the loss of home, and the fear of death, remaining full of wonder in the process of confronting these dark topics.

About the Author

Frank Soos is the Alaska State Writer Laureate, 2015–2016. He taught writing at the University of Alaska, Fairbanks, from 1986 until 2004. His publications include Double Moon: Constructions and Conversations (with Margo Klass), Bamboo Fly Rod Suite (essays), and Unified Field Theory (stories).
